Nutritional Comparison With Other Rice Varieties

When it comes to nutrition, wild rice blend stands out among other rice varieties due to its impressive nutrient profile. Compared to standard white rice, wild rice blend contains more protein, fiber, and essential minerals. In fact, a one-cup serving of wild rice blend provides approximately 7 grams of protein, making it a valuable source for individuals looking to increase their protein intake.

Additionally, wild rice blend contains significantly more fiber than white rice. High fiber content is linked to various health benefits, including improved digestion, reduced risk of heart disease, and better blood sugar control. Furthermore, wild rice blend contains a variety of essential minerals such as phosphorus, zinc, and magnesium, which are important for maintaining overall health and well-being.

In contrast to brown rice, wild rice blend offers a higher amount of protein and certain nutrients. Although both rice varieties provide important nutrients, wild rice blend’s unique combination of protein, fiber, and minerals make it a compelling choice for individuals seeking to add more nutritional value to their diet.

Incorporating Wild Rice Blend Into Your Diet

Incorporating wild rice blend into your diet is a simple and effective way to enhance your nutritional intake. This versatile grain can be used in a variety of dishes, making it easy to include in your daily meals. Consider using wild rice blend in soups, salads, casseroles, and pilafs to add a nutty flavor and a satisfying texture to your dishes.

You can also substitute wild rice blend for other grains like white rice or quinoa to boost the nutrient content of your meals. This can be particularly beneficial for those looking to increase their fiber and protein intake, as wild rice blend is a good source of both. Additionally, incorporating wild rice blend into your diet can provide essential vitamins and minerals, including folate, magnesium, and zinc, which contribute to overall health and well-being. Whether as a side dish or a main ingredient, adding wild rice blend to your diet is an easy way to elevate the nutritional value of your meals.
